Transaction 59bf012da2a34db8f4ba595f39cd1134a1e83db73842208c789c06e4c1769aeb

1 Input
2 Outputs
  • 59bf012da2a34db8f4ba595f39cd1134a1e83db73842208c789c06e4c1769aeb:0
  • value  17450000
    address  378MYsyF3WiUzvN5GpzjtTTkgYLyEJE3JG
  • 59bf012da2a34db8f4ba595f39cd1134a1e83db73842208c789c06e4c1769aeb:1
  • value  17853128
    address  3Drag1eMXdgtenw1KHY1AXfswVA8oWzJaH